Allows you to control the firmware device tamper detection feature. This feature
notifies the user when the firmware device is tampered. When enabled, a screen
warning messages are displayed on the computer and a tamper detection event
is logged in the BIOS Events log. The computer fails to reboot until the event is
cleared.
By default, the Firmware Device Tamper Detection option is enabled.
For additional security, Dell Technologies recommends keeping the Firmware
Device Tamper Detection option enabled.
The Administrator Password prevents unauthorized access to the BIOS Setup
options. Once the administrator password is set, the BIOS setup options can only
be modified after providing the correct password.
The following rules and dependencies apply to the Administrator Password -
● The administrator password cannot be set if system and/or internal hard drive
passwords are previously set.
● The administrator password can be used in place of the system and/or
internal hard drive passwords.
● When set, the administrator password must be provided during a firmware
update.
● Clearing the administrator password also clears the system password (if set).
Dell Technologies recommends using an administrator password to prevent
unauthorized changes to BIOS setup options.
The System Password prevents the system from booting to an operating system
without entering the correct password.
The following rules and dependencies apply when the System Password is used -
● The computer shuts down when idle for approximately 10 minutes at the
system password prompt.
● The computer shuts down after three incorrect attempts to enter the system
password.
● The computer shuts down when the Esc key is pressed at the System
Password prompt.
